What is digital switchover?
Starting in 2008 and ending in 2012, TV services in the UK will go completely digital TV region by TV Region. This process is called digital switchover.
Switchover will involve changing the current television broadcasting system to digital, as well as ensuring that people have adapted or upgraded their television and recording equipment to receive digital TV.
With very rare exceptions, all TVs can be converted to digital with a digital box, even black and white ones. Visit your local retailer or TV rental company for more information on available products and how to connect them.
If you don’t already have a digital TV, you will need to convert your television equipment to digital.
You have four options –
· Get a digital box and plug it into your existing TV or get an integrated digital television which
has a tuner built-in – these will give you digital TV through an aerial (digital terrestrial);
· Subscribe to digital cable;
· Choose digital satellite, which has both subscription and free options;
· Subscribe to a service which delivers digital TV through a telephone line.
The availability of the different types of digital television will vary depending on where you live. Check out the available options in you area by using the Digital UK postcode checker.
Communal Aerials for NBBC Flat Blocks
NBBC has prepared a programme of works to replace communal aerials to its blocks of flats. The programme will commence in April 2009 and should be completed in 2010.
If you have a television at present you will keep it, but existing aerials will be removed and you will receive a signal from the communal aerial. If you have a satellite dish, you will have your dish removed and you will be able to receive Sky digital signals, as well as terrestrial digital-analogue television, FM radio and digital radio transmissions from the communal dish. Residents without satellite will have the option, once the system is installed, to link in to the Sky system via the normal purchasing route, but without the need for a dedicated dish.
The work will be carried out by Commercial Televisions Systems (UK) Ltd, who will contact tenants/leaseholders prior to commencement of works with further details, start dates and access requirements.
